How To Fix F6578 - Subordinate funds centers exit: Deletion not possible


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: F6 - Funds Management Master Data Maintenance

  • Message number: 578

  • Message text: Subordinate funds centers exit: Deletion not possible

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message F6578 - Subordinate funds centers exit: Deletion not possible ?

    The SAP error message F6578, which states "Subordinate funds centers exit: Deletion not possible," typically occurs in the context of fund management within SAP. This error indicates that there is an attempt to delete a funds center that has subordinate funds centers or is linked to other financial transactions, making it impossible to delete.

    Cause:

    1. Subordinate Funds Centers: The funds center you are trying to delete has subordinate funds centers. In SAP, a funds center can have a hierarchical structure, and if there are child funds centers linked to it, the parent cannot be deleted.
    2. Active Transactions: There may be active transactions or commitments associated with the funds center, preventing its deletion.
    3. Configuration Issues: There might be configuration settings that restrict the deletion of funds centers under certain conditions.

    Solution:

    1. Check Subordinate Funds Centers:

      • Navigate to the funds center hierarchy in SAP and check if there are any subordinate funds centers linked to the one you are trying to delete. If there are, you will need to delete or reassign those subordinate funds centers first.
    2. Review Transactions:

      • Check for any active transactions, commitments, or budget allocations associated with the funds center. You may need to clear or reallocate these transactions before attempting to delete the funds center.
    3. Use the Correct Transaction:

      • Ensure you are using the correct transaction code for deletion. The typical transaction for managing funds centers is FMX1 (Create Funds Center) and FMX2 (Change Funds Center). Use FMX3 to display and verify the details before deletion.
